Garbage can now help in producing hydrogen

Garbage hydrogenThere is never an abundance of fuel as need for fuel is increasing day by day, while all the present resources of fuel are running dry across the world.
With the daily consumption of fuel increasing everyday, researchers have to find out new and efficient forms of energy. And this is when and how researchers have found out that is it possible to use the garbage that is thrown out, for producing hydrogen.

According to these researchers, all types of biodegradable garbage that ranges from sewage to left over food are all sources of valuable hydrogen fuel.
This is because it is possible to use this garbage to produce the alternative to fossil fuels, hydrogen fuels using the help of microbes that have been cultivated in special reactors.

It is because of the fact that researchers know that the burning of hydrogen only produces energy and water that they had started looking for ways for generating hydrogen en masse.
With this, the researchers hope to stop, and replace use of fossil fuels, which its burning only leads to the release of the global warming gas, carbon dioxide.

Though hydrogen is meant to replace the burning of fossil fuels, ironically, today most of the available hydrogen is generated from fossil fuels.
Looking for an alternate source for hydrogen was the inspiration provided to environmental engineers. And with this inspiration, they have managed to perfect a means of generating hydrogen from biodegradable garbage like the organic matter from animals, plants and other organisms.

Though this idea was announced in 2005, it was improved with newer work of taking liquid waste like effluent from sewers, food processing plants and breweries to use for feeding to soil-or-wastewater derived bacteria.
This bacteria is grown in reactors that have been specially designed so that its growth is fostered.

It is these microbes that then break down the organic matter, and in the process, release hydrogen gas. With this breakthrough in environmental science, it is now possible to turn all sorts of wastewaters into a renewable source of energy, hydrogen.
This is better than the previous methods of using energy to treat waste water.

With further research, these researchers have found that these microbes need to have a low voltage supplied to them.
This is to help these bacteria generate the hydrogen and this fact was found out by the researchers in 2005. However, basically, the burning of some of the hydrogen that has been produced by the bacteria can be used to generate electricity that is required by the germs to produce the gas.

This theory of procedure was envisioned in 2005 by researchers, mainly as a means of cutting down on sewage costs. However today these researchers state that these reactors are equally capable of working as hydrogen producers.
Not only is garbage waste stuffed into these reactors, stuffing them with cellulose that is found in plants helps in producing hydrogen.

Once this technique is mastered and considered a safe and efficient means of hydrogen production, there are ideas on improving the rates of hydrogen production and in the process, lower the cost of reactor materials.
